Seeking skilled IT professionals? Look no further than Europe's thriving remote talent pool. With a rich history of technological innovation and a diverse range of expertise, European developers are well-equipped in https://alpha-global.org/
Unleash European Virtual IT Resource
Internet - 3 hours ago alyshalabc793326Web Directory Categories
Web Directory Search
New Site Listings